Evidence of a lipstick comes from mesopotamia in around 3000 B.C.E. It was made from crushed semi precious jewels and then put on the eyelids as well as the lips. Ancient Egyptian are first lovers to use colored paste on lips.

Cleopatra, pharoah of Egypt used crushed carmine beetles in a base made of ants as lipstick. Some formulations would resulted in serious illness or even death, such as the Ancient Egyptian concoction, which used a red dye extracted from seaweed, mixed with iodine and toxic bromine compounds.

Maurice levy invented the sliding tube now known as a lipstick in 1915. Levy’s tube was just 5cm long.the sliding tube worked by a set of slide lever in the casing. After some developments, levy added sliding-and-twist mechanism which we are using now a days.
